WebAug 31, 2024 · Buyer Portion of Transfer Tax – $5,000 (2%) So Will Save $1,250 of the state transfer tax on the purchase of a $250,000 home in Delaware. The county portion of $1,875 may also be exempt for Delaware First Time Home Buyers if property is located in the county and not inside the city limits of a municipality. someone saved my life tonight guitar chords

WebApr 17, 2024 · State Transfer Tax Exemption. If you have never owned property in Maryland and are purchasing a home that will be your principal residence, you are eligible for first-time homebuyer discount at closing.
